About
Our
Chapter

American Institute of Chemical Engineers at the University of Minnesota strives to provide students direct access to potential employers as well as an open social atmosphere giving students a chance to work on homework and study together. The principal activities include chemical engineering company presentations and site tours, car team meetings in preparation for student AIChE conferences, as well as social get-togethers throughout the fall and spring semesters.

To become a registered member of your UMN AIChE Student Chapter there are 2 main steps.

  1. First you need to register for the AIChE national organization. Registration for the national chapter is free to undergraduates and comes with many resources that can support your professional development. AIChE nationals will send you a confirmation email which can be forwarded to our student chapter at aiche@umn.edu

  2. Second students must attend at least two meetings or events per semester in order to be considered an active member. Example of vents include:

    • General meetings​

    • Company sponsored AIChE meetings

    • Committee or board meetings

    • Car Team, etc..
